Alexander Pappas is originally from Idaho but his love for music took him to Australia. According to his record label, "His pursuit of music eventually led him to Sydney, Australia where he served at Hillsong Church and gained renown as, co-frontman of twice GRAMMY nominated Hillsong Young & Free. During his tenure, Pappas led some of the biggest cries of praise and worship for the next generation, penning iconic, genre-defining youth anthems such as “Alive,” “Wake,” “Real Love,” and “Echo (Elevation Worship),” songs that have literally changed the world." Enjoy the weekend and enjoy this new music, Idaho!

NKOTB Flashback: New Kids on the Block MixTape Tour 2019

In 2019, NKOTB embarked on their first MixTape tour that grossed over $53.2 million dollars and sold over 650,000 tickets across the United States. The tour featured special guests Salt-N-Pepa, Tiffany, Naughty by Nature and Debbie Gibson. It included a stop at what was at the time Taco Bell Arena on June 4, 2019.
